使用AI语音SDK构建智能语音交互机器人的指南
随着科技的不断发展,人工智能技术在各个领域都得到了广泛应用。特别是在语音识别和语音交互方面,AI语音SDK的出现,使得构建智能语音交互机器人成为了一种可能。本文将为您讲述一个使用AI语音SDK构建智能语音交互机器人的故事,希望对您有所启发。
故事的主人公是一位名叫李明的程序员。李明对人工智能技术一直非常感兴趣,尤其对语音识别和语音交互领域有着浓厚的兴趣。然而,由于缺乏相关经验,他一直无法将想法付诸实践。
有一天,李明在网络上偶然发现了一款名为“AI语音SDK”的软件。这款SDK提供了丰富的语音识别、语音合成、语音交互等功能,让开发者可以轻松构建智能语音交互机器人。李明立刻被这款SDK所吸引,决定尝试用它来实现自己的梦想。
首先,李明在网上查阅了大量关于AI语音SDK的资料,了解了其功能、使用方法和相关技术。然后,他开始着手搭建自己的开发环境。由于是第一次接触这类技术,李明遇到了很多困难。他请教了身边的朋友,也查阅了大量的在线教程,逐渐掌握了AI语音SDK的基本使用方法。
在搭建开发环境的过程中,李明遇到了一个问题:如何让机器人能够理解用户的语音指令?为了解决这个问题,他开始学习语音识别技术。通过研究,李明了解到,语音识别技术主要包括声学模型、语言模型和声学解码器三个部分。为了实现语音识别功能,他需要分别搭建这三个部分。
在搭建声学模型时,李明遇到了一个难题:如何获得高质量的语音数据。经过一番搜索,他发现了一个在线语音数据平台,可以免费下载大量的语音数据。他下载了这些数据,并使用AI语音SDK提供的工具对数据进行预处理。
接下来,李明开始搭建语言模型。语言模型是语音识别的核心部分,其作用是将声学模型输出的声学特征转换为文本。为了构建语言模型,李明需要收集大量的文本数据,并对这些数据进行标注。他花费了大量的时间和精力,最终成功构建了一个简单的语言模型。
在完成声学模型和语言模型的搭建后,李明开始着手搭建声学解码器。声学解码器负责将声学模型输出的声学特征转换为文本。李明使用AI语音SDK提供的工具,将声学模型和语言模型结合,实现了语音识别功能。
接下来,李明开始构建语音交互机器人。他首先定义了机器人的功能,包括语音识别、语音合成、语义理解、对话管理等。然后,他使用AI语音SDK提供的API接口,将各个功能模块整合到一起。
在构建机器人过程中,李明遇到了很多挑战。例如,如何实现自然流畅的对话?如何让机器人理解用户的意图?为了解决这些问题,他不断优化代码,改进算法,最终实现了机器人与用户的自然对话。
在完成机器人开发后,李明开始测试机器人的性能。他邀请了多位用户参与测试,收集了他们的反馈意见。根据反馈,李明对机器人进行了多次优化,使其在语音识别、语音合成、语义理解等方面都达到了较高的水平。
经过一段时间的努力,李明终于完成了自己的智能语音交互机器人。他将这个机器人命名为“小智”。小智可以回答用户的问题、提供生活服务、进行娱乐互动等。它的出现,让李明的家人和朋友们都感受到了人工智能的魅力。
这个故事告诉我们,只要有梦想,并付出努力,我们就可以实现自己的目标。AI语音SDK为我们提供了一个强大的工具,让我们可以轻松构建智能语音交互机器人。只要我们勇于尝试,不断学习,就一定能够在人工智能领域取得成功。
在未来的发展中,AI语音技术将会越来越成熟,应用场景也会越来越广泛。我们可以预见,智能语音交互机器人将在教育、医疗、客服、智能家居等领域发挥重要作用。而李明的故事,也将激励更多的人投身于人工智能领域,为我国人工智能事业贡献力量。
猜你喜欢:AI语音开放平台